In an electrophilic substitution reaction to nitrobenzene, the presence of nitro group.

Answer»

Deactivates the ring by inductive EFFECT
Activities the ring by inductive effect
Decreases the charge density at ortho and para POSITION of the rinf relative to META position by resonance.
Increases the charge density at meta position relative to the ortho and para positions of the ring by resonance.

Solution :NITRO GROUP deactivates the benzene ring due to -I effect and decreases electron density at ortho and para positions than meta position. An electrophilic attacks on meta position.
